X-Wing Rogue Squadron 12, also labeled as "Battleground: Tatooine, Chapter 4", is the twelfth issue in the Star Wars: X-Wing Rogue Squadron series of comics. It was released on September 11, 1996 by Dark Horse Comics.

Plot summary[]
The members of Rogue Squadron that had gone to Ryloth return to Tatooine. The other Rogues are shocked to see Imperial troopers emerge from Winter's freighter, but Winter offers an explanation while they travel. Elsewhere on Tatooine, Captain Marl Semtin explains to Firith Olan that Imperial official Sate Pestage embezzled funds from an Imperial military operation to build a private retreat on Tatooine. After flying into a rock face that was actually a holographic cover, Semtin and Olan enter Eidolon Base, with the Eidolon cruiser supposedly housed on Tatooine being a fake. The base is stocked with art, wealth and weaponry, and Semtin explains that Lirin Banolt died after threatening to expose the base. Semtin offers for Olan to manage the base and become the de facto governor of Tatooine, which Olan accepts.
Rogue Squadron and the defected Imperials fly to Eidolon Base and watch TIE Interceptors fly out of the holographic mountainside. The defectors, led by Sixtus Quin, storm the base on foot. Olan, who had deployed his forces for an aerial attack, panics; not wanting to risk Olan falling into Alliance hands, Semtin stabs him. Olan crawls out of the holographic wall, falling to the ground to be met by Bib Fortuna's droid-walker.
In the air, Rogue Squadron battles the TIEs. Tycho Celchu's X-Wing is hit, and despite Winter's pleas, he "goes out with a bang", much to Winter's shock. Against Wedge Antille's orders, Elscol Loro flies out of atmosphere to attack the orbiting Star Destroyer Harrow, entering its docking bay and causing a catastrophic decompression by destroying its containment field. Plourr Ilo crash-lands on the surface and is rescued by Kapp Dendo. Quin finds Semtin, who offers to make Quin rich, but is killed by Quin, who is insulted by his lack of honor. With the last TIEs destroyed and the base secured, the Rogues emerge victorious.
Back at base, Antilles consoles Winter concerning Celchu, revealing that "going out with a bang" is code for ejecting and letting the X-Wing's R2 unit go for a suicide run. At Huff Darklighter's estate, the Rogues celebrate and Winter finds Celchu, giving him the kiss she promised him when they first arrived on Tatooine. Antilles offers Elscol Loro a position as leader of Tatooine's government-backed liberation force, armed by the captured Imperial weaponry; Loro gratefully accepts.
At Jabba's palace, Fortuna, whose brain has been placed in Olan's body by the B'omarr monks, awakes fully recovered. Fortuna expresses his happiness at being organic again and continuing to work with Olan, whose brain was placed in a walker-droid of its own, and declares that the name of Bib Fortuna will once again ring proudly throughout the galaxy.

Collected in[]
- Star Wars: X-Wing Rogue Squadron: Battleground: Tatooine trade paperback
- Star Wars Omnibus: X-Wing Rogue Squadron Volume 2
- Star Wars Legends Epic Collection: The New Republic Vol. 2
- Star Wars Legends: The New Republic Omnibus Vol. 1
